Skip to content

Commit 1a7e362

Browse files
authored
support --inherit-environ when reusing a venv (#288)
1 parent 0e745d2 commit 1a7e362

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

pyperformance/venv.py

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-171,6 +171,7 @@ def create(cls, root=None, python=None, *,
171171

172172
@classmethod
173173
def ensure(cls, root, python=None, *,
174+
inherit_environ=None,
174175
upgrade=False,
175176
**kwargs
176177
):
@@ -184,6 +185,7 @@ def ensure(cls, root, python=None, *,
184185

185186
if exists:
186187
self = super().ensure(root)
188+
self.inherit_environ = inherit_environ
187189
if upgrade:
188190
self.upgrade_pip()
189191
else:
@@ -193,6 +195,7 @@ def ensure(cls, root, python=None, *,
193195
return cls.create(
194196
root,
195197
python,
198+
inherit_environ=inherit_environ,
196199
upgrade=upgrade,
197200
**kwargs
198201
)

0 commit comments

Comments
 (0)